Every product has to start with an idea, and at Heyside we believe the best ideas deserve to become real-world products. Our New Product Development (NPD) process starts with a conversation with our customers, to understand their needs and provide the technical insight to make a product function properly.
Using advanced CAD software and vast experience from working with sectors ranging from traffic management to the water industry, we give our customers a direct route from concept to manufacture. We review products with our clients all the way through development, with 3D modelling helping to bring designs to life visually.

Once a product design has been agreed, we move on to prototyping. Using our 3D printers, in this step we create a physical representation of what the customer’s end product will look like. At this stage we test and refine further, to verify shapes, materials, and product elements before the final tooling is created.
We can create physical samples throughout the design and prototyping processes, using our in-house tooling to improve accuracy and minimise risk before full-scale production begins. When our customer has signed off the prototype samples, we then move on to making the mould for full scale production.

Once the mould has been created, the final step is manufacturing the product. This is where we select with the customer the material to manufacture the product – often from our high-quality blend of recycled waste plastic. All the material Heyside use is also 100% recyclable at end of life – and feeding it into one of our industrial injection moulding machines.
The process involves molten material being injected under high pressure into the custom-made mould, ensuring consistency and structural integrity for each product. After checking in again with our customers and reviewing the final product, we can scale up manufacturing, using our mass production capabilities across our 40,000 sqft UK factory.
If a customer decides further down the line they want to update the product, we take a step back to the design and prototyping stage and amend the product appropriately, before redesigning the tooling and starting production again.
